Understanding Civil Law: When Do You Need a Lawyer?
Civil law involves disputes between individuals, organizations , or sometimes, an individual and the government . Unlike criminal cases, civil law focuses on rectifying harm or injuries rather than punishing offenses . You might find yourself needing a lawyer professional in a variety of situations, such as contract disagreements, property disputes, bodily harm claims, marital dissolution proceedings, debt collection matters, or libel cases. Evaluate seeking representation from an expert if you’re faced with a lawsuit, uncertain about your rights, or believe your interests are being harmed .
- Contract Disputes: A disagreement over terms.
- Property Issues: Disputes over ownership or boundaries.
- Personal Injury: Seeking compensation for injuries.

Civil Lawyer Costs & Options: A Detailed Breakdown
Navigating this civil legal framework can be costly , and grasping the associated costs is vital . Usual civil lawyer rates vary widely based on things like area , the intricacy of your situation , and attorney's expertise . Typical payment structures include hourly rates , which can fluctuate from $150 to more than $500 an hour, success fees (typically used in negligence actions), and flat fees for particular services . Considering alternative dispute resolution approaches can also possibly lower total legal costs .
